The Pros and Cons of a White Car Black Hood

Like any color combination, there are pros and cons to choosing a white car black hood. One of the pros is that it is a classic color combination that will never go out of style. It is also a great way to make a statement and stand out from the crowd. However, one of the cons is that it can be difficult to maintain. The white paint can show dirt and grime more easily, and the black hood can be prone to fading.

How to Maintain a White Car Black Hood

To keep your white car black hood looking its best, there are a few things you can do. First, make sure to wash your car regularly to remove any dirt and grime that may have accumulated. You should also wax your car at least twice a year to protect the paint from fading. Finally, avoid parking your car in direct sunlight for extended periods of time, as this can cause the black hood to fade.
